Variant summary

Our verdict is Uncertain significance. Variant got 1 ACMG points: 5P and 4B. PVS1_StrongPP5BS2

The NM_025129.5(FUZ):c.98_111+9del variant causes a splice donor, splice donor 5th base, coding sequence, intron change. The variant allele was found at a frequency of 0.0000155 in 1,549,496 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Likely pathogenic (no stars).

Genes affected
FUZ (HGNC:26219): (fuzzy planar cell polarity protein) This gene encodes a planar cell polarity protein that is involved in ciliogenesis and directional cell movement. Knockout studies in mice exhibit neural tube defects and defective cilia, and mutations in this gene are associated with neural tube defects in humans. Al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Jul 2012]
